Frequently Asked Questions

Can we get merch before the show?

Absolutely! Just head on over to the GirlyPop website to see the full range: https://girlypop.uk/shop/

Who needs a ticket?

Everyone who is attending the event (with the exception of those entitled to a carer companion ticket) will need a ticket to enter.

Can we bring our own food?

Street food and sweet treats are available at GirlyPop, so no externally bought food or drink is allowed at this event.

Can boys come to this event?

Absolutely! If they're over 5 years old and would enjoy this, please do bring them!

Does my teenager need to be accompanied?

Everyone who is under the age of 18 needs to be accompanied by a responsible adult over the age of 18.

Is this event suitable for my noise-sensitive/light-sensitive child?

You know your child better than we do, but we do ask you to consider that these are loud events with special effects and flashing lights before purchasing tickets. If you think your child will enjoy the event but they are noise-sensitive, we would recommend bringing ear defenders with you for your child to wear.
